How they compare
Bahamas currently reports 80 against 80 in Saint Kitts and Nevis, a difference of 0.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Bahamas ahead.
Bahamas ranks 50th and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 50th of 179 countries.
Bahamas has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bahamas | Saint Kitts and Nevis |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 79.7 | 76.4 | 3.3 | Bahamas |
| 2010s | 80.2 | 78.5 | 1.7 | Bahamas |
| 2020s | 80.25 | 79.75 | 0.5 | Bahamas |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
